Donald L. Blount and Associates (DLBA) recently completed the design of the 105 Yachtfish project, a concept project vessel that combines characteristics of long-range cruising yachts and modern sportfishing boats. The 105 Yachtfish project has been developed on the basis of enabling eight guests, a captain, and two crew to cruise on extended trips on a vessel that is properly outfitted and configured for real sport-fishing, without sacrificing the comfort and amenities that should be found on a modern motor yacht.

The efficiency of the 105 Yachtfish motor yacht relies on a very long and slender hullform designed to provide increased efficiency and extended range over the higher-speed planing hulls found on most modern sportfishing boats. While slower than most modern sportfishing boats, the shape of the hull allows for an efficient cruise speed that is higher than for typical displacement yachts of similar length. A high sprint speed is possible in the event the owner intends to tournament fish or has other reason to travel faster than at cruise speed. Twin diesel engines coupled with recently-developed pod-drives will allow the 32m Yachtfish to reach a top speed of over 25 knots; cruising at 13.5 knots will extend the vessel’s range up to 2800 nautical miles.

The main deck of the 105 Yachtfish concept contains a salon that opens up forward to a large galley and dining room, and aft to an expansive mezzanine deck perfect for watching the fishing action. Three steps down lead to the cockpit, properly equipped with fish boxes, icemaker, bait and tackle stations, and a fighting chair.  Upstairs from main deck, a second large salon is located immediately aft of the bridge, providing 360-degrees of visibility and opening aft to a large exterior deck overlooking the cockpit. Forward, the bridge of the 32m Yachtfish opens on both sides to an exterior walk-around at the forward end of the house.
